Florida football is hoping the sting of another loss to rival Georgia won't carry over into the first of two straight road games when it plays Nov. 8 at Kentucky (7:30 p.m., SEC Network) at Kroger Field.
The Florida Gators (3-5, 2-3 SEC) will play its second game under interim coach Billy Gonzales after UF came up a few plays short in a 24-20 loss to the rival No. 5 Bulldogs in Jacksonville.
